Will I need an Education degree, or just a degree in Mathematics to teach at a college or university?

You need an MFA to teach full time at a 4 yr university and a MA to teach either part-time at a 4 yr, or full-time at a community college. You only need a credential for high school and below.
At the university level you do not usually need an education degree just usually a PhD. in the subject you will teach.
As the others have said, you do not need a teaching certification. You need at least a Masters degree. A Ph.d in math is difficult and many do not have it. You need plenty of math college course work and would probably specialize in your masters such as be a statistics wiz or another area of math.

Colleges require at least a masters degree with at least 18 graduate ours in the field in which you want to teach. You probably will need a terminal degree — a doctorate — to do more than adjunct teaching unless you have some other credential — like a CPA along with your masters.
College teachers don’t have to have any education courses at all.
